Stark County, Ohio's ZIP 44647 registers 21/100 composite distress, which DLRadar reads as low. The most distinctive pressure shows up in structural risk (48/100), construction/permit lag (26/100), institutional ownership (17/100). institutional ownership (17/100) and mortgage stress (7/100) stay muted. Climate and flood risk are elevated too — climate & FEMA risk (88/100), flood (NFIP) exposure (77/100). On the structural side it scores 48/100, with 2/100 of stress already active.
Prices here sit in a expansion phase: values rose 6.6% over the trailing year, and 18% higher over three years (phase confidence 34/100). Even climbing markets leave specific parcels in distress; the scoring isolates them.
At $65,974, median income runs below typical U.S. levels. The ZIP holds roughly 8,234 housing units. The poverty rate is 10.5%. Around 28% of renters are cost-burdened. 17,851 residents call 44647 home, typically aged 43. The demographic-stress sub-score lands at 24/100. 78% of housing is owner-occupied. The vacancy rate is 6.3%. Around 16%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The typical home is worth about $155,200 (2.1× income, relatively affordable).
